What is VoIP?
Some people call it VoIP, Voice Over Internet Protocol or a broadband phone service. They're all different ways of describing the latest technology that allows you to save on your phone bill. You make and receive phone calls just like you did before, using a regular phone but instead of your calls being delivered over a regular phone line they travel over your high speed internet connection.
